Abstract

The invention discloses a soil loosening device for planting polygonatum sibiricum, which relates to the field of polygonatum sibiricum planting and aims at solving the problems that the existing soil loosening device for planting polygonatum sibiricum is low in efficiency and uneven in soil height after loosening. The method can effectively improve the soil loosening efficiency, can flatten loosened soil with different thicknesses, is convenient for subsequent sealwort planting operation, and is suitable for popularization.

Disclosure of Invention
The invention provides a soil loosening device for polygonatum sibiricum planting, which solves the problems that the existing soil loosening device for polygonatum sibiricum planting is low in efficiency and the soil height after loosening is uneven.
In order to achieve the purpose, the invention adopts the following technical scheme:
a soil loosening device for planting sealwort comprises a top plate, wherein side plates are fixedly connected to four corners of the bottom of the top plate, an air cylinder is fixedly installed at the middle position of the bottom of the top plate, a piston rod of the air cylinder is vertically and downwards fixedly connected with a transverse mounting plate, the mounting plate is located between the side plates, two groups of symmetrically distributed vertical plates are fixedly connected to the bottom of the mounting plate, a first loosening roller and a second loosening roller are respectively rotatably installed between the vertical plates of each group, rotating shafts at one ends of the first loosening roller and the second loosening roller penetrate through the vertical plates and extend to the outer sides of the vertical plates, a second belt pulley and a third belt pulley are respectively fixedly connected to the outer sides of the vertical plates, a driving motor is fixedly installed at the bottom of the mounting plate and located between the two groups of vertical plates, and two first belt pulleys with the same structure are fixedly sleeved on an output, and all be connected with driving belt between first belt pulley and second belt pulley and the third belt pulley, be close to two of second loose roller be connected with the connecting plate that is the slope between the curb plate, just the shakeouts the device is installed to the end of connecting plate.
Preferably, the bottom ends of the side plates are provided with movable wheels.
Preferably, the both sides of mounting panel are provided with two sets of sliders that are the symmetric distribution, the inside wall of curb plate all is provided with the spout along its direction of height, and spout and slider match, and sliding connection.
Preferably, the middle position of the bottom end of the mounting plate is fixedly connected with a baffle plate which is vertically arranged.
Preferably, the circumferential side walls of the first loosening roller and the second loosening roller are respectively provided with loosening teeth which are uniformly distributed, and the distance between two adjacent loosening teeth on the first loosening roller is larger than that on the second loosening roller.
Preferably, the shakeout device includes diaphragm, shakeout board, regulation carousel, threaded rod and guide bar, the terminal fixedly connected with diaphragm of connecting plate, just the intermediate position threaded mounting of diaphragm is vertical threaded rod, and the threaded rod runs through the diaphragm, the bottom of threaded rod is rotated and is installed and be vertical shakeout board, and the top fixedly connected with of threaded rod adjusts the carousel, two guide bars that are the symmetric distribution of shakeout board's top fixedly connected with, just the guide bar slides and runs through the diaphragm.
Preferably, the adjusting turntable is provided with insertion holes in a through mode, the top end of the transverse plate is provided with pin holes arranged in an annular array mode, and pins are installed in the pin holes and the insertion holes in a matched mode.

The first embodiment is as follows: when the polygonatum planting soil needs to be loosened, the device is moved to a soil area to be loosened, then the device is pushed to move, the driving motor 20 is started at the same time, the output shaft of the driving motor 20 drives the two first belt pulleys 10 to rotate, the first belt pulley 10 drives the second belt pulley 8 and the third belt pulley 11 to rotate through the transmission belt, so that the second belt pulley 8 drives the first loosening roller 6 to rotate, the soil is preliminarily loosened through the loosening teeth on the first loosening roller 6, meanwhile, the third belt pulley 11 drives the second loosening roller 21 to rotate, the soil after the preliminary loosening is loosened again through the loosening teeth on the second loosening roller 21, in the process of soil loosening, the air cylinder 3 can be controlled, so that the air cylinder 3 drives the mounting plate 4 to move in the vertical direction, the mounting plate 4 drives the sliding block 19 to slide in the sliding groove 18, and the loosening depth of the soil is adjusted by the device;
